Women's golf wins Sewanee Fall Invitational
Bookmark and Share
WINCHESTER, Tenn. - The BSC women's golf team took first place at the Sewanee Fall Invitational at The Bear Trace at Tim's Ford in Winchester, Tenn.  The Panthers shot a combined 658 to win by 42 strokes.

Ashley Lovell led the leaderboard with a combined two-day total of 159.  She finished seven strokes under her teammates Gaukhar Amandossova and Jennifer Commander who both finished in second with a 166.  Michelle Morris was right behind them at 167 for the tournament and Marissa Gacek rounded out the Panther scores with a 183 on the weekend.

Lovell, Amadossova, Commander, and Morris were all named to the All-Tournament team.

The Panthers will host the Ann Rhoads 'Southern Shootout September 27th through the 28th at the Highland Park Golf Course.
